Pleasant Hill
The city of Pleasant Hill is a vibrant community, rich in educational resources and recreational open space; proudly claiming a thriving, award-winning downtown and business district. Centrally located in Contra Costa County, with Interstate 680 and BART, running north/south offering easy freeway access to Oakland and San Francisco.
Downtown Pleasant Hill is home to the Art, Jazz & Wine Festival held each October. You will also find a seasonal Farmer’s Market from May through November.
Residential housing ranges from well established, quiet family neighborhoods to newer affordable housing in the walkable downtown area that was established in 2000. This redevelopment is in the area around Contra Costa and Monument Boulevards. It may be new, but it feels like home.
There’s lots to do in Pleasant Hill. Keep your kids active with one of the summer camps offered by the Park & Rec department, from Pre-School to Teens, from Lego day camp to Mad Science, unlimited fun is waiting. Newly opened, the Pleasant Hill Community Center is will be the locale for many events including the Wine Women & Shoes annual fundraiser.
The Dolfin Swim Team offers instruction and team competition, with an emphasis on conditioning and self-improvement. Pleasant Hill parks offer everything that you would expect, softball, basketball, playgrounds, volleyball, bocce, BBQ facilities, swimming, water play……….there’s even a park for your dog!
Pleasant Hill students are served by the Contra Costa County Office of Education School District. Included are six elementary schools, three middle schools and one high school. Diablo Valley College and John F. Kennedy University provide opportunity for higher education.
